Understanding Different Kitchen Counter Products
When selecting countertops for a kitchen area, comprehending the different products readily available is crucial, as each alternative supplies one-of-a-kind advantages and downsides. Granite, for example, is valued for its durability and natural appeal, making it a preferred choice amongst house owners. However, it calls for regular sealing to preserve its resistance to stains. Quartz, on the various other hand, is crafted and offers a non-porous surface area that is immune to microorganisms, yet it might not have the same all-natural variations as rock. Laminate counter tops are affordable and offered in many layouts, though they may not stand up to high warmth or heavy impacts as well as various other products. Timber countertops supply heat and charm but require normal upkeep to prevent damage. Ultimately, the choice of product depends upon the house owner's way of living, spending plan, and aesthetic preferences, making it vital to consider these factors meticulously before choosing.

Maintenance and Toughness Considerations
Choosing countertops entails mindful factor to consider of upkeep and resilience, as these factors significantly impact long-term satisfaction and capability. countertop installation. Different materials provide varying levels of maintenance; as an example, natural stone may require routine sealing to stop discoloration, while quartz is usually a lot more immune to damage and less complicated to maintain
Longevity is another critical element; surface areas like granite and quartzite can endure warm and scratches, making them excellent for active cooking areas. On the other hand, softer products such as laminate might show wear quicker, demanding regular replacements.
Furthermore, the ease of cleaning must not be overlooked. Non-porous surface areas usually enable basic wipe-downs, while porous materials might require specific cleaners to stay clear of damages. By weighing these maintenance and durability factors to consider, house owners can make informed choices that line up with their lifestyle, ensuring their kitchen counters stay both practical and aesthetically appealing gradually.

Covert Installation Costs
While evaluating product prices is an important step in the counter top upgrade procedure, property owners must likewise be conscious of surprise installation expenses that can significantly impact the overall budget. These often-overlooked costs may consist of labor costs, which can vary significantly depending upon the complexity of the installment. Additional costs might arise from the requirement for specialized devices or tools, especially when taking care of larger materials like granite or quartz. Moreover, unforeseen website prep work, such as getting rid of old countertops or making structural changes, can further pump up costs. Home owners need to consider these possible expenses to develop a sensible budget, ensuring that their wanted visual does not bring about monetary strain.
